WebFeb 16, 2024 · Various types of birth control work in different ways. Birth control methods may: Prevent sperm from reaching the egg. Inactivate or damage sperm. Prevent an egg from being released each month. Alter the lining of the uterus so that a fertilized egg doesn't attach to it. Thicken cervical mucus so that sperm can't easily pass through it.
